Aurora Event Center Building New York

Aurora Event Center Building New York

Set on the eastern shore of the Cayuga Lake in upstate New York, the Aurora Event Center is envisioned as a year-round event space accommodating weddings for up to 250 guests. The primary design intent is to create a strong connection to the lake and frame its picturesque views.

The Shop at the CAC New Orleans, Louisiana

The Shop at the CAC New Orleans

The Shop is a comprehensive co-working development at the Contemporary Arts Center, New Orleans (CAC). Targeting technology, arts, and cultural-based businesses; The Shop serves as a hub of entrepreneurship in the developing Downtown innovation corridor.

House at Charlebois Lake, Québec property

House at Charlebois Lake, Québec property

On a wooded lot on the shore of Charlebois Lake, Paul Bernier Architecte designed a contemporary house, luminous and open to the nature. The clients wanted most of the spaces of the house to be level with the land.

New Emanuel Synagogue Woollahra, Sydney

New Emanuel Synagogue in Woollahra

Lippmann Partnership designed the New Emanuel Synagogue for the congregation which embraces religious pluralism offering a variety of different services and streams. It is the fastest growing religious congregation in the southern hemisphere.

General Motors Design Auditorium Michigan

General Motors Design Auditorium Michigan dome

General Motors Design Auditorium in Warren, Michigan, designed by Eero Saarinen, a legendary corporate master piece of planning and design. The architect placed special attention on the spaces concerned with designing, prototyping and evaluating new automobile styles.
